Perch in line for Forest return
Nottingham Forest could have James Perch available for the trip to St James` Park to face Championship leaders Newcastle.
Perch, a transfer target for the Magpies in January, missed the home win over Crystal Palace after suffering a recurrence of an ankle problem.
But the Reds hope that after receiving a pain-killing injection, the versatile 24-year-old will get the all-clear to figure in the travelling squad.
Full-back Joel Lynch is edging closer to a return to full fitness after a thigh injury and may also be involved.
Victory would see Billy Davies` side become the only team this season to complete a league double over the Magpies having beaten them 1-0 in the reverse fixture at the City Ground in October.
